NFI Massachusetts Inc., a non-profit human services agency, is seeking compassionate and dedicated Awake Overnight Assistant Supervisor to join our team at Wilmington, MA.
Our Milestone residential program support youth who are in need of temporary out-of-home placement and serve a range of populations including adolescents and transitional age youth (ages 12–22) with emotional, behavioral, and mental health challenges, often with histories of complex trauma. Youth are referred through the Department of Children and Families (DCF).
An Awake Overnight Assistant Residential Supervisorplays a vital role in supporting youth development by creating a safe, structured, and therapeutic environment. Staff mentor and guide youth in developing life skills, building social and interpersonal competencies, and engaging in their communities. The ultimate goal is to prepare youth for successful transitions back into the community and towards greater independence.
$24.00/hour with overtime opportunities available
